We examine the entire structure and determine any major defects, future or urgent maintenance issues and problems that are caused by the gradual degradation. We check for structural issues or any indication that the property is a leaky building and issues caused by delayed maintenance, such as weatherboards that are rotting due to peeling paint and areas that are damp or mould.

Take Care to Look Out For

The following issues could be costly to deal with:

Black plastic pipe: You should look for them if your house was constructed or rebuilt in the late 1970s or early 1980s. They are known to leak. Insurance companies will not cover any damage caused by this pipe even if you were aware that they were there.

Weatherside siding: The weatherboard can leak. If the home was built in the 80s, it could be equipped with Weatherside.

Monolithic Plaster cladding: Used in the late 1980s through the mid 2000s Many "leaky homes" have this cladding. The exterior walls usually are smooth or unbroken appearance.

Asbestos products: Used widely from the mid-1940s through the mid-1980s. It may be installed on roofs, ceilings under lino, fences. If asbestos is discovered in the property, seek expert guidance on the risk it poses, the very best way it could be removed, how long it would take to remove, and the cost for removal.

Pre-Purchase Building & House Inspections Kelson

Our detailed pre-purchase inspection will reveal any issues that might need remedial attention.

  • A thorough assessment of the structure and weather-tightness every visible component.
  • An assessment of services for the building (given affordable access).
  • A brief overview of outbuildings, immediate grounds and site drainage.
  • Non-invasive moisture testing for areas with high risk and potential issues like window and door penetrations , as well as rooms that are wet (bathrooms laundry, baths, etc.) is part of the standard service we offer.
  • Identification of maintenance-related items.
  • Recognising additions and modifications post original construction requiring authorisation or consent.
